HORIZONTAL AIR DIRECTION CONTROL
The horizontal air direction is adjusted by moving
the vertical louvers right and left with your
fingertips. (FIG. 24)
VERTICAL AIR DIRECTION CONTROL
The vertical air direction is adjusted by moving the
horizontal louvers up and down with your fingertips.
(FIG. 25)
